Vista Land & Lifescapes, Inc.

(PSE:VLL) is expanding its hotel portfolio through


the development of a new hotel brand, Mella. Vista Land founder and Chairman
Manuel B. Villar said the company is set to develop four hotels in key cities.

Here are three interesting facts about Vista Lands Mella Hotels.

1. Mella Hotels will be located in Las Pias City, Boracay, Tagaytay, Daang Hari
and Bataan. VLL has allotted varied budgets for the development projects.
Villar said the Mella hotels in Las Pias will have P500 million and P600 million
budget. The hotel in Boracay will have a budget of P1 billion.

Were trying to grow fast so that the ratio of the leasing income compared with
the housing [sales] income will be comparable with the leaders of the
industry, Business World reported Villar, as saying. Villar is referring to other
real estate firms SM Prime Holdings, Inc. (PSE:SMPH), Ayala Land, Inc.
(PSE:ALI), and Megaworld Corp. (PSE:MEG), which are already offering varied
real estate brands from hotels, malls, residential projects, and BPO offices.

2. The Mella Hotels will have around 150 rooms. It will cater to the middle-class
segment and should be categorized under three-to four-star quality of
accommodation and related services.
The Boracay branch of the Mella hotel will be located next to the upscale Shangri-
La Resort. The Tagaytay branch is planned to be located next to Crosswinds Swiss
Luxury Resort, which is also owned by VLL.

3. Villar said the Mella brand will make VLL a complete real estate company. It
is part of the companys vision towards 2020.
By 2020, Vista Land will be completely different and will be a complete real
estate company. There will be horizontal and vertical residential projects, hotels,
malls and BPO offices, Villar said. He added that the company intends to develop
1.3 million square meters of malls, retail stores and business process outsourcing
(BPO) commercial centers by 2018.
